    maq map merge

    Hi

    I have 2 .map files from two paired end alignments using maq map.
    Merged them using ./maq mapmerge expt1.map expt2.map output.map

    The total reads in output.map should be 18 million (expt1 + expt2) but is only 12 million. Any idea as to what happened to the remaining 6 million reads?

    For example, an alignment at chr 1 position 1 should appear a total of 3 times in the merged output file, but is only there once. Yes the flag is poor in 2 of the positions..so if there is more than one alignment at a certain position does maq mapmerge only take the best qaulity?
